EAF uses DRI as a supplement in the production of steel, unlike BOF producers who use only iron ore and steel scrap. ... Saudi Arabia, and Oman. The share of gasbased DRI production process is higher compared to its coalbased counterpart, particularly in India and Saudi Arabia. Producers in China however continue to adhere to coalbased process for DRI production. .

 · Scrap metal. Iron and steel scrap is used as a secondary raw material, both for scrapbased and orebased steel production. The scrap is sorted into different classes and the steel plants utilise a mixture of the types of scrap that best suit the steel that it is intended to produce. Iron ore of size 5 mm to 20 mm is being used for the production of Sponge iron. Iron ore is being fed to the Ground hopper, from where it conveyed to the Screen with the help of Vibro Feeder, where Oversize + 20 mm and Undersize – 5 mm is being removed by screening.
